The color #222106 is a dark orange that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 34, 33, 6 and HSL values of 58°, 70%, 8%.

Complementary Colors for #222106
The complementary color for #222106 is #060723.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#222106
These are the darker variations of #222106.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#1B1A05 and #141404. This progression shows how #222106 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
